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

LINQ to SQL - Lỗi loại trả về thủ tục đã lưu trữ

Đảm bảo rằng bạn có:

SET NOCOUNT ON;

là dòng đầu tiên trong SP của bạn sau câu lệnh 'BEGIN'.

Nếu SP của bạn không có điều này, thì nó sẽ trả về các thông báo như

'10 Rows affected...'

Linq cố gắng diễn giải như một phần của kết quả hàm. Ngà đã cắn tôi rất nhiều lần !!



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L Server - Các ký tự không hợp lệ trong tên tham số

  2. Làm cách nào để chèn bản ghi vào bảng cơ sở dữ liệu sql server express?

  3. Sự cố truy vấn vùng tên Xml của SQL Server

  4. Làm cách nào để tìm kiếm một chuỗi trong cơ sở dữ liệu SQL Server?

  5. Thuộc tính NUnit Rollback dường như không thành công trên SQL Server 2005